Mumbai Woman Dies, Daughters Injured After 'Drunk' CISF Driver Rams Into Auto

A CISF constable, allegedly drunk, rammed a Scorpio into an auto on Mumbai’s Western Express Highway, killing a woman and injuring three.

A woman was killed, and three, including her two daughters and the auto driver, were injured after a car rammed into an auto. The incident occurred on Mumbai’s Western Express Highway in Goregaon, Maharashtra, in the early hours of Thursday. The car was driven by Central Industrial Security Force  (CISF) constable Dhundaram Yadav, who was allegedly under the influence of alcohol.

As per IANS, the case was registered with the Vanrai Police, and all the injured are undergoing treatment at a nearby hospital. The police arrested the CISF personnel.

A police official told PTI that he lost control of the SUV, hit a road divider and then smashed into a three-wheeler. The mother, Hazra Ismail Shaikh, 48, died on the spot, while the injured were rushed to the hospital.

“Yadav was charged under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ita and the Motor Vehicles Act for culpable homicide not amounting to murder as well as other offences. He has been remanded in police custody for two days," the official told the news agency.

According to The Indian Express, the accused CISF driver was driving a Scorpio service vehicle on the southbound stretch when he lost control, and the vehicle jumped the divider, crashing into an auto-rickshaw on the Goregaon East flyover.

The Scorpio had “POLICE” written on its windshield.

As per the report, Shaikh’s husband, who was traveling in another auto-rickshaw nearby, rushed his injured wife and daughters to Trauma Care Hospital in Jogeshwari for immediate medical attention.

“Yadav’s blood test report confirmed he was under the influence of alcohol, hence we arrested him under charges of culpable homicide not amounting to murder among other charges,” said Raju Mane, senior inspector of Vanrai police station told The Indian Express.

Yadav had picked up the SUV from a garage in Malad East, where it had been sent for repairs, and was en route to the CISF camp in Santacruz when the accident occurred.
